Tristan Lee is a talented model, actor, poet, and fashion designer. Tristan was diagnosed with Sickle Cell as a baby at six months old. School was always challenging for him as he was out sick from sickle cell most days. It was always a struggle for Tristan to keep up with the other kids both psychically and mentally, but through the grace of God he did and graduated on time.
Despite having had a stroke early in life, Tristan has pressed forward to accomplish great things, including an almost complete recovery through therapy, dedication, and hard work, and there are many more great things yet to come for him. He does a lot of charity work advocating for the South Central PA Sickle Cell Council of Harrisburg, PA helping them raise awareness for this cause.
